import cv2 as cv
import numpy as np
img=cv.imread('learn.jpg',cv.IMREAD_GRAYSCALE)
cv.imshow('first image',img)
img_size=img.shape
print(img_size)
imgkernel=np.array([[-2,-1,0],
[-1, 1,1],
[ 0, 1,2]]
)
print(imgkernel)
#利用CV的卷积核卷积图像
dst=cv.filter2D(img,-1,imgkernel)
cv.imshow('filter img',dst)
print(dst.shape) #可以查看数组没变,说明为same方式卷积
img_dst=np.hstack((img,dst))
cv.imshow('merge img',img_dst)
cv.waitKey()
cv.destroyAllWindows()
